Solve: x24x5<0x^2 - 4x - 5 < 0 (Non-linear preview)

A.

1<x<5-1 < x < 5

✓ Correct
B.

x<1x < -1 or x>5x > 5

C.

5<x<1-5 < x < 1

D.

x<5x < -5 or x>1x > 1

Detailed Explanation

Choice A is correct. Choice A is the correct answer. Factor and test intervals. 1. Factor: (x5)(x+1)<0(x - 5)(x + 1) < 0 2. Roots: x=5,x=1x = 5, x = -1 3. Test Intervals: - x<1x < -1: Neg ×\times Neg = Pos (>0>0) - 1<x<5-1 < x < 5 (e.g., 0): Neg ×\times Pos = Neg (<0<0) - x>5x > 5: Pos ×\times Pos = Pos (>0>0) 4. Result: 1<x<5-1 < x < 5 Strategic Tip: "Less than" for a parabola opening up is the region "between" the roots. Choice B is incorrect because it describes the outside region (>0>0). Choice C is incorrect because it has wrong roots. Choice D is incorrect because it has wrong roots.
